FDA Hears OTC Plan for Emergency Contraceptives
By Allison Dunne
Albany, NY – Representatives from some women's and medical groups want to make emergency contraception available over-the-counter across the nation. They are presenting evidence today to the Food and Drug Administration to do so. WAMC's Hudson Valley Bureau Chief Allison Dunne spoke with people from both sides of the debate.
